For a good pre, try something that may also enhance your ability to retain information during school hours; such as Focus XT.

Apart from that, there's no real need for anything heavy as at your age your test is pumping already. Get on a good program -preferably one designed for you by someone who knows how to program or a generic one that is well reputed, such as 5x5, P.H.A.T or something then get diet in check.

With that, you'll get solid results independent of supplements.
